Graphic design is an art form that allows visual communication through the use of images, typography, layout, and color. It’s used to create logos, ads, posters, websites, and more. Adobe Photoshop and Illustrator are popular programs for creating graphics, but did you know that you can do graphic design without Adobe?
Yes – it is possible to create high-quality graphics without using Adobe software! There are other programs out there such as Sketch, Gravit Designer and Inkscape that offer similar features without the price tag associated with Adobe products.
Additionally, many of these alternative programs offer features that can be beneficial for some projects. For example – Sketch has an interface specifically designed for designing mobile apps while Inkscape is tailored towards vector graphics.
Another great way to create graphics without Adobe is to use online tools such as Canva or Visme. These tools have a wide range of templates and stock images which can be used to quickly create eye-catching designs. They also provide helpful tutorials and guides on how to use their tools so even beginners can get started right away.
Lastly, if you’re looking for a free option then there’s GIMP – the open source image editor. GIMP offers a lot of the same features as Photoshop but doesn’t come with all the bells and whistles like layers or brushes. However, it does have enough features to get most basic jobs done such as resizing or cropping images.
Conclusion:
Yes – you don’t need Adobe software in order to do graphic design! There are plenty of alternatives out there ranging from free open source programs like GIMP to paid ones like Sketch or Gravit Designer. You can also use online tools such as Canva or Visme which provide helpful tutorials and templates so even beginners can get started quickly with creating graphics.
